  1. Well, I re-installed and tried doing the changes step-by-step, checking for the "install" button each time.

     

    It seemed to disappear after the following step from the documentation: Editing catalog/admin/categories.php, going down to the replace around line 298.

     

    The "replace" code was:

     

    tep_db_query("insert into " . TABLE_PRODUCTS . " (products_quantity, products_model, products_image, products_price, products_date_added, products_date_available, products_weight, products_dim_type, products_weight_type, products_length, products_width, products_height, products_ready_to_ship, products_status, products_tax_class_id, manufacturers_id) values ('" . tep_db_input($product['products_quantity']) . "', '" . tep_db_input($product['products_model']) . "', '" . tep_db_input($product['products_image']) . "', '" . tep_db_input($product['products_price']) . "',  now(), '" . tep_db_input($product['products_date_available']) . "', '" . tep_db_input($product['products_weight']) . "', '" . tep_db_input($product['products_length']) . "', '" . tep_db_input($product['products_width']) . "', '" . tep_db_input($product['products_height']) . "', '" . tep_db_input($product['products_ready_to_ship']) . "', '0', '" . (int)$product['products_tax_class_id'] . "', '" . (int)$product['manufacturers_id'] . "')");

     

    The items "products_dim_type" and "products_weight_type" seemed to be causing the problem. When I deleted them, but replaced the rest of the code "as is", the "install" button and info panel on the shipping modules remained intact.

     

    So... I've got the info panel back, but... Have I just deleted part of the code that is essential for this shipping module to work?!?

    The Info panel is at the bottom of the code page, so the page is stopping before it gets to that point in the code. Look at the page source and you can see where it is stopping. This can be caused by errors in editing catalog/admin/modules.php or by a module file with errors. If you have recently edited the modules.php file, replacing that file with your backup should solve the problem temporarily. If you need to edit the file for whatever reason, you will need to fix the errors in your edit for this to work.

     

    If you have recently added a shipping module, this can be fixed temporarily by removing the broken module file. A permanent fix will require fixing the errors in the module file or by replacing it with a good copy of the file. If your server has error reporting turned on, you should see an error message that will give you a hint where to find the problem. You may need to look at the page source to read the message. If errors are not displayed, look at your server error log for the error messages.
